DO NOT GO HERE!I very rarely give 1 star. Let's get to it.The meat is overcooked and dry, under seasoned, really small and over priced. The best flavored skewer was the chicken breast skewer topped with wasabi... because I could only taste the wasabi, not dry and bland chicken. We averaged like 1 skewer every 10 minutes after about ~45 minutes of waiting and then sides. We were there for over 2 hours for almost no food. There is one tiny grill, like a home Asian style table top grill. He could only make maybe 15ish at a time.It's $27, per person, for food plus a min of ~$4 per drink with a mandatory 20% surcharge MINIMUM. The menu is deceptive. The Yakatoriya combination is $25 for 5 skewers and some tiny sides of salad and broth. That means, I had to order their cheapest, single, skewer for $3.50. So, about $30 for one person on bad food that was so little it left a hunger an 8 piece Chicken Mac'Nugget meal could have filled better instead.They also had this peak COVID obsession with sanitizer. They wore masks, had plastic wrap all over their cook area, had mandatory hand sanitizer on entry and messages everywhere about cleaning and sanitizing.

If you’re looking for a quick bite of a few sticks of skewered chicken and an assortment of Japanese side dishes, look elsewhere to eat since Yakitoriya will not be quick.If you however are looking to enjoy a leisurely evening of meticulously handcrafted, deliciously seasoned authentic yakitori chicken skewers and assorted grilled vegetables with chicken and an array of chicken centered side dishes, along with a few non-chicken sides, then Yakitoriya is a place to go.Chef Toshi Sakamaki’s dedication to his craft, his desire to serve each skewer hot off the grill personally to each patron, scurrying from behind the counter to deliver his expertly created morsels piping hot to the outer tables while his wife creates delicious side dishes to accompany your meal, is almost a lost art in today’s fast paced restaurant culture.Our party of five spent 2 hours tonight at Yakitoriya and enjoyed the standouts of truffle chicken, grilled duck breast, thigh, wing, meatball and vegetable with sliced chicken skewers, Zosui, green salad with house dressing, Japanese style fried chicken and chicken broth.Tonight’s dinner reminded me of going to a relative’s house who painstakingly spent an entire day prepping a delicious meal just for us with such variety and personally cooking each item to be eaten piping hot for the best flavor and experience.Be prepared for strict ordering policies, but your taste buds will be rewarded.
